AWANA NEWS
Ever since the fall of 1999, our AWANA Club has sponsored a needy AWANA Club in Jamaica.  You can see letters and pictures from them on the bulletin board near the back door of the church.  The dues that your child brings each week go to help these children buy handbooks, uniforms, and awards.  We have designated February as Adopt-a-Club month.  Each child who brings at least $4.00 during February will receive an Adopt-a-Club patch or pin to wear on their uniform.  Help us show God's love to our Jamaican AWANA friends.
